How long does it take to steam pears? Efficacy and function of steamed pears.
1 How long does it take to steam pears? About 20-30 minutes.

Pears contain a variety of vitamins and cellulose, which can be eaten raw or cooked. In the process of steaming, pears can reduce the original acidic substances in pears, while retaining the effect of moistening the lungs.

The specific time of steaming pears depends on personal preference. If you like to eat soft and rotten pears, you can appropriately extend the time of steaming pears to ensure their taste. It is recommended to steam pears for about 20-30 minutes, because steaming for too long will affect the taste.

4 what kind of pear is better for steamed pears? Generally, steamed pears need to be cooked at high temperature, so it is recommended to choose pears with slightly larger size and harder pulp, such as Sydney, Apple Pear and crown pear.
